A Fraud Marketplace: How Illicit Credentials Is Traded
The shadowy underworld of cybercrime has a unique hub: the carding site. These underground online venues operate beyond the reach of legitimate law enforcement, providing a digital dark platform for the buying and distributing of compromised financial data. Individuals, often organized into complex criminal groups, obtain credit card numbers, personally identifiable information, and other sensitive data through various methods, including malware attacks. These ill-gotten gains are then listed for exchange on carding marketplaces, often organized by issuer and region. Prices differ significantly based on the quality of the records and the degree of confirmation performed by the vendors. It's a disturbing illustration of the ongoing battle between cybercriminals and those working to protect user financial protection.
